Runbook: Scanline barcode bridge

If warehouse scans stop flowing into Cartwheel, it's almost always the bridge service on the Dunmore floor box wedging after a USB hiccup. Bounce the service first — nine times out of ten that fixes it. If not, check the queue depth before escalating. When restarting, make sure the bridge comes up with these settings.

deployment values, yafop-bajef:
[gilok]
team = ulaius
access_code = ac_423664
host = gilok.sivrelhq.corp
port = 9200
owner = pelius.istax
peer = eliok.torvasoft.internal

Ticket: Staging env misconfigured for Siftgate bloom filter

The bloom layer in front of the Pellet KV store is rejecting all lookups in staging because the env file was copied from the dev template without credentials. False-positive tuning values are fine; only the auth line is missing. To unblock the weekly demo, the Pellet admission secret must be set on the following line.

env line for yaguf-fajop: LEDGER_TOKEN13=fb08984397349

# Sniffly env file — encoding detection service
# On-call notes: Sniffly guesses the charset of uploaded text files before the
# Fernmark pipeline ingests them. If users report mojibake, check DETECT_MODE
# below (strict vs. lenient) before touching anything else — nine times out of
# ten someone flipped it during an incident and forgot. Lenient is the default.
# The line right after this comment block sets the callback signing secret.

env line for fafof-fahag: LEDGER_TOKEN5=f8790